Scientists at the Oklahoma Medical Research Foundation have received a $3 million grant to explore avenues to improve heart health.Dr. An Chao studies a coenzyme called NAD+ that is present in cells throughout our bodies. NAD+ was first discovered by scientists over a century ago. Compounds that boost NAD+ levels are sold as over-the-counter dietary supplements under a variety of trade names and are touted as potentially improving energy production, metabolism, and healthy aging.According to market research reports, NAD+ boosters account for 14% of all dollars spent on anti-aging products. The Executive Secretary, Civil Society Extension Nutrition in Nigeria (CS-SUNN), Mrs Sunday Okoronkwo, has called on state lawmakers to pass a law allowing six months maternity leave to enable women to practice exclusive breastfeeding. He made the call during a two-day legislative conference that brought together lawmakers from the 13 states of the federation to strategize and suggest solutions to the challenge of malnutrition in their states. The 2024 Legislative Retreat on Key Nutrition IssuesCS-lSUNN will take place from June 25th to 26th at the Dover Hotel, Ikeja, Lagos. If you’re packing a potato or pasta salad for a picnic, try cooking and cooling the carbohydrates first: “This will help reduce blood sugar spikes by increasing the amount of resistant starch, which acts like fibre and is a great source of food for the good bacteria in your gut,” says nutritionist Madeleine Shaw.17.
